Day 2: Island Exploration and History

Start your second day on Pigeon Island by exploring the rich history of the island. A visit to Pigeon Island National Landmark is a must during your trip. The site of a former British military base, the landmark features historic ruins and artifacts that date back to the 18th century.

While at the landmark, take some time to hike to the top of the Fort Rodney Lookout Point. From this vantage point, you can take in panoramic views of Pigeon Island and the surrounding area. You’ll understand why the British chose to establish a base on this beautiful island.

As you explore, keep an eye out for local wildlife such as iguanas and tropical birds that can only be found on Pigeon Island.

Indulge in Local Delicacies

No trip to Pigeon Island is complete without indulging in the local cuisine. Sample fresh seafood dishes, like grilled lobster, at the famous Jambe de Bois restaurant. Or try some local delicacies like saltfish and green banana or breadfruit and fried jackfish at one of the small eateries in town.

Explore Ritzy Rodney Bay

About a 10-minute drive from Pigeon Island, Rodney Bay offers more hustle and bustle than the island’s laid-back vibe. Explore high-end shopping destinations and enjoy the variety of bars and restaurants in the area. Head to Reduit Beach to soak up some sun.

Discover Secret Beaches

While Pigeon Island is known for its lovely beaches, there are some hidden spots that locals love. Visit Lover’s Beach or Smuggler’s Cove, and it’s likely you’ll have the place to yourself. Bring a picnic basket, enjoy a serene environment and listen to the sound of the waves.

Diamond Botanical Gardens

If you’re interested in beautiful botanical gardens and warm mineral springs, then Diamond Botanical Gardens is the place for you. Located just 30 minutes from Pigeon Island, this natural wonder features impeccable gardens, including the Diamond Waterfall and various birds and tropical wildlife. To top it off, the hot mineral springs will soothe any sore muscles from your exciting Pigeon Island adventures.

Derek Walcott Square

If you’re interested in the history and culture of St. Lucia, then make sure to visit Derek Walcott Square in Castries. The square is named after the famous Nobel laureate and is home to the Castries Central Market and many other fascinating historical landmarks.
